Marc Lobliner has confirmed that his very first edible product is on the way, and with a name like Cookie Cakes it definitely sounds like it’s going to be delicious. The big differences with the protein-packed snack are that it is an actual cake and apparently being produced in a bakery, not the usual protein bar manufacturer.

20g of protein with around 30g of carbohydrates and 7g of fat. It’s also made of only natural ingredients, with its protein all coming from grass fed whey isolate.

What is the difference between 1.3 dimethylamylamine and 1.4 dimethylamylamine? I know what 1.3 dimethylamylamine is. I tried googling 1.4 dimethylamylamine. Is it DMHA?

1,3 is the more "used" dmaa. It's strong and fast acting. It provides that quick rush. 1,4 dmaa is not dmha. Dmha is 2-aminoisoheptane. 1,4 dmaa is a different breed from 1,3. It is still strong but it is slower acting. Almost like time release. 1,3 will get you there. And 1,4 will carry you while you're up there. 1,4 also has some appetite suppression qualities which is why we use it in our fat burner.

How is 1,4 slower acting? Do you mean its less of a vasopressor so it effects aren't felt as hard as 1,3? (At the same dosage)

That's a good way to put it. When you take something with 1,3 ,in my experience, you start to feel more energetic when you get moving. It's not like a rush of anything but you feel ready to go. And like all stims, after a while you start to come down. With 1,4 it would just take longer to come down. Think of it as a parabola or a bell curve. 1,3 has a quick incline, a decent peak and moderate decline. You don't crash from it but after a while the energy you had is gone. 1,4 has long stretched out incline, little peak, and a long decline (this is where the appetite suppression is noted.) when you mix the two you have a quick incline, a long peak, and a long decline.
